Dryness after PRK: PRK eye surgery can temporarily cause or exacerbate dry eye. During the surgery, the tips of the nerve endings that sense dryness are removed as the surface of the eye is reshaped. Those nerve endings grow back. It normally takes 3-6 months. If the dryness is not better after 6 months, there may be an underlying dry eye condition not related to the surgery that needs to be treated.
